html写post登录验证
时间: 2024-10-01 07:06:42 浏览: 14
HTML本身并不直接用于POST登录验证,它主要是标记语言,负责页面结构和内容展示。通常,POST登录验证的过程涉及到服务器端脚本如PHP、Python、Node.js等与HTML结合使用。以下是一个基本步骤:
1. **创建HTML表单**:在HTML中,你可以创建一个表单,包含用户名输入框`<input type="text" name="username">`、密码输入框`<input type="password" name="password">`以及提交按钮`<button type="submit">登录</button>`。
```html
<form action="/login" method="post">
<label for="username">用户名:</label>
<input type="text" id="username" name="username"><br>
<label for="password">密码:</label>
<input type="password" id="password" name="password"><br>
<input type="submit" value="登录">
</form>
```
2. **发送POST请求**:当用户点击提交按钮,表单会向指定的服务器地址(这里假设是`/login`)发送一个POST请求,其中包含了用户名和密码的数据。
3. **服务器处理**:在服务器端,如PHP,你会接收到这个POST请求,然后解析数据,与数据库进行比对,如果验证通过,就会进行后续操作(比如设置session或cookie),否则返回错误信息。
4. **响应与错误处理**:服务器响应可能会是一个JSON对象,告诉前端登录成功与否,前端根据响应更新界面或者显示错误消息。
**注意**:实际应用中,为了安全,你应该使用HTTPS,并对敏感数据(如密码)进行加密传输和存储。